The Creevey Papers offers a deliciously candid and indispensable window into the corridors of power and the drawing rooms of high society during the late Georgian and Regency eras. Thomas Creevey, a shrewd Whig politician and an insatiable gossip, documented the political intrigues, social scandals, and monumental events of his day with unparalleled wit and sometimes startling indiscretion. From unvarnished critiques of the Prince Regent to firsthand accounts of the aftermath of Waterloo, this collection of diaries and correspondence, meticulously curated by Sir Herbert Maxwell, remains one of the most entertaining and historically significant personal records of nineteenth-century Britain. With several portrait plates. Thomas Creevey, 1768-1838, was an English politician. "Creevey's charm and good humour made him both popular and a delightful… guest; his fame derives from the amusing letters preserved by the Ord family. His importance as a historical source is considerable. No one described more graphically the appearance, or recorded more faithfully the looks and the talk, of the royal personages and major politicians of the time" -DNB. Sir Herbert Maxwell, 1845-1937, was a politician and author. "His editing of the Creevey Papers (2 vols., 1903) provided a valuable supplement to the Greville Memoirs" -DNB. In half morocco bindings.
